Overseas Tourbillon in a new look, studded with stunning baguette cut pieces
Vacheron Constantin is a renowned Swiss watch manufacturer with a rich history dating back to 1755 when it was founded by François Constantin, along with Jean-Marc Vacheron in Geneva, Switzerland. The company has the distinction of being the oldest continually active watch manufacturer. In 1977 the brand introduced the iconic “Historiques 222”, commemorating the 222nd anniversary of the Swiss watchmaker. The "222" was a vintage luxury wristwatch that epitomized the aesthetic and technical characteristics of sports watches. This timepiece, with its bold design, has continuously evolved, becoming a symbol of Vacheron Constantin's commitment to excellence.
In 2016, the Overseas collection redefined Vacheron Constantin’s spirit, reflecting a sense of travel and exploration. The Overseas Tourbillon was introduced at SIHH 2019, marking a new addition to the Overseas collection. It comes in a stainless steel case measuring 42.50 mm in diameter with a slim 10.39mm profile. Notably, it houses Vacheron Constantin's ultra-slim tourbillon calibre 2160, the brand's first-ever automatic tourbillon movement. Now, the brand released the “Overseas Tourbillon High Jewellery” with an 18K white gold case distinguished by its bezel set with 60 baguette-cut diamonds for the first time.
The new timepiece is crafted from 18k white gold, remaining faithful with its dimensions to its predecessors captivating us with its design. Surrounding the sapphire crystal is a bezel adorned with a stunning display of 60 baguette-cut diamonds, elevating the watch's allure.The transparent sapphire crystal caseback provides a glimpse into the intricate inner workings, with a screw-down crown, this timepiece is water-resistant up to 50m. Notably, the soft-iron casing ring ensures anti-magnetic protection.
The brass blue lacquer dial boasts a beautiful sunburst finish. Accentuating its allure are 18k white gold hour markers adorned with 9 placed baguette-cut diamonds, infusing a touch of opulence. The hour and minute hands, also crafted in 18k white gold, are coated with Super-LumiNova, ensuring enhanced visibility in any lighting conditions. At 6 o'clock position, the tourbillon takes center stage, commanding attention with a hand mirror-polished bridge that features a small seconds counter.
Powering this timepiece is the ultra thin VC calibre 2160 measuring 31mm diameter x 5.65mm thickness, an automatic movement with a 22k gold peripheral gold rotor. It boasts 80 hours of power reserve, and operates at 18,000vph (2.5Hz). This movement is decorated with hand-beveled bridges adorned in Côtes de Genève.

The 18k white gold integrated bracelet is secured with a triple-blade folding clasp equipped with a comfort-adjustment system. Additionally, the watch includes a blue calfskin leather strap with grey stitching and a blue rubber strap, both accompanied by interchangeable 18k white gold pin buckles adorned with 16 baguette-cut diamonds.
